Moving your home belongings and transferring to a new house is one of the most essential activities that you will carry out. Thats why its essential for you as a consumer to end up being familiar with the moving industry and to much better understand your rights and obligations when you move.

While many trucking business are now needed only to get the correct authority to operate and to be signed up with the Department of Transportation, interstate movers should fulfill two additional requirements. Movers should release their tariffs (a tariff is the movers price list for performing moving services) and make them readily available for inspection by any consumer who asks to see a copy. Second, movers are needed to take part in a Conflict Settlement Program and to use neutral arbitration as a means of dealing with disputed loss and damage claims and particular kinds of disputed charges.

The majority of people who use an expert mover never ever have a problem or need to submit a claim. And the vast majority of claims that are submitted are solved to the consumer's complete satisfaction in a timely manner. Issues do sometimes happen that can not be quickly resolved. Part 5 of this Guide directs you to more information for assistance in handling problems ought to they take place.

Why You Need To Use A Professional Mover

Expert movers supply an important service by moving thousands of people to brand-new houses each year. While nearly no move is ever totally trouble-free, when you utilize a professional mover, all of the heavy lifting will be done for you. Movers will pack your belongings, fill them into the truck, drive the truck to your destination and unload and unpack your shipment at your brand-new house. Movers can likewise supply you with storage facility storage, move your piano up and down flights of stairs, transport your automobile, and service your appliances to insure their safe transportation.

If you are thinking about moving yourself, specifically if you will be moving interstate, you need to ask a lot of questions and compute the actual costs of self-moving before you sign a contract with a truck rental company. When assessing the cost and worth of professional moving, the information in this part of the Consumer Guide will help you to determine self-move expenses and offer you a basis of contrast.

For an interstate relocation, you will require to supply the truck rental business with your origin and location cities and the date you prepare to move. The majority of individuals move at the start of a month or the end of the month, so prices may be even higher during these times. The rental charge does not include state taxes or other equipment you may need to complete your move, such as cartons, pads, dollies and boxes.

Ensure you lease the best size truck! Keep in mind, effectively packing a truck is an art, not a science. After a long, difficult day of packing all of your worldly belongings into the back of a rental truck, the last thing you require to find is that you have actually lacked area however not out of furnishings.

Cars. The number of automobiles do you have? Are you going to drive or tow the automobile( s)? A trailer plan from a rental business can cost an extra $150, plus another $45 for the trailer drawback together with a $200 deposit depending upon how numerous days you are leasing the trailer. If you are driving your own automobile, you'll require to element in wear and tear on your automobile.

It might cost an extra $20 a day or more for insurance coverage during your move. Most cars and truck insurance coverage policies do not cover truck leasings, so you will require to buy separate liability insurance and property damage insurance coverage. Many of these extra policies do not cover you against theft; so if your goods are stolen (truck theft can be an issue if you are leaving the totally packed car unattended while you spend the night at a hotel) you may not have any defense.

Pads normally cost $10 a dozen; with a 26 foot truck (four bed room home), you will require at least 3-dozen pads. You may need device dollies, energy dollies, or furnishings dollies to help move heavy furniture and devices.

Who will pick-up, load, drive and dump the rental truck? Figure out your average hourly wage and increase it times the overall number of hours you estimate it will take to pack, pick-up the truck, load, drive, dump, and so on for you and your spouse/family. This is the per relocation value of your time.

You may be able to gather totally free boxes in anticipation of the move, however to lessen damages, particularly for an interstate move, it is extremely suggested that you purchase specialized boxes, like closets, meal packs, and mattress containers. You'll need tape to protect the boxes and paper padding to secure the contents of the containers prior to they are packed on the truck.

Expect to pay about $200 for a 4-bedroom house, plus another $100 or so each for the kitchen area and a home office, if you buy your boxes from a truck rental company. Some truck rental business also offer filling and discharging service to load your furnishings and the boxes that you have packed yourself. This service can include several hundred dollars to the expense of your relocation; be sure to get an estimate prior to your sign-up for this service.

Mileage Charges. Mileage charges are typically consisted of in the rental contract but might be limited; read this article an extra mileage charge might be assessed at a typical cost per mile, usually around 40 cents a mile for each additional mile over the limitation. Be sure to read your agreement to see if there are additional mileage charges or costs for one-way rentals.

Fuel Charges. The car will be complete of fuel when you choose up your truck. You must return the automobile with a full tank or the rental business might charge a higher than typical price per gallon to fill the lorry. You'll need to compute the expense of fuel used while driving the rental automobile. A 26-foot truck that is fully filled will average about 10 miles per gallon. You will consume 120 gallons of fuel if you take a trip roughly 1200 miles/10 miles a gallon. At an average cost of $3.00 a gallon x 120 gallons, your fuel cost will be $360.

Fridges, grandfather clocks, cleaning machines, gas stoves, and so on all may need special preparation and managing to prevent them from being harmed when they are moved. You may require to hire numerous specialists to make sure proper handling of your ownerships.

Storage. Is your destination home available for tenancy? If not, where will you store your belongings? You might need to protect a warehouse and dump all your household items into storage. The most common storage centers available for the self-mover are small storage facility storage units. While functional, these systems may offer less than appropriate protection for your personal belongings. Security may be very little, generally a manager sleeping on the facility, no insurance protection, and no protection from fire or smoke damage.

When your new home ends up being available you will require to lease another truck, reload all your belongings from the storage facility, deliver your products to the last destination, and unload whatever one last time.

Other Extra Costs to consider are:

Buddies and family members that assist you move will include additional costs like food and drinks.
Do you have children and are they too young to take care of themselves? You might have childcare costs if you are doing whatever yourself.
When moving heavy articles like furnishings, back injuries can take place. You may wish to buy a back brace to minimize lower back strain.
Can you drive to the new location in one day, or will you be needed to spend one or more nights in a hotel? Who will enjoy the truck while you sleep? Security might also be a concern.
Tolls for highways and/or bridges might also apply
